Gardiner Adult Education offers college campus tours

GARDINER — Gardiner Adult Education will offer college tours during the months of March and April. Potential students will have the opportunity to tour the University of Maine at Augusta, Southern Maine Community College in Brunswick, Kennebec Valley Community College in Fairfield, and Central Maine Community College in Auburn.

Maine schools already using the new model

Based on staff research, these 22 Maine schools and districts are using at least some form of the proficiency-based education model being promoted by the Maine Department of Education. The schools are at different stages and are approaching it from different angles, such as using standards-based grading systems, or allowing students multiple ways to demonstrate they’ve mastered content.

LOCAL COLLEGE ROUNDUP: Colby sweeps doubleheader

FORT MYERS, Fla. — Mike Mastrocola had a grand slam and five RBIs in the first game, then had a pair of doubles in the second game as the Colby College baseball team beat Western Connecticut State University 11-2 and 7-2 in a doubleheader Friday.
